Ama-ultra-high voltage transformers onke angama-semi-insured transformer, futhi ukwahlukanisa komhlaba kwekhoyili yamaphoyinti angathathi hlangothi kubuthakathaka kunezinye izingxenye. Ukwehlukaniswa kwephoyinti elingathathi hlangothi kwehlukaniswa kalula. Ngakho-ke, ukuvikelwa kwegebe kudinga ukulungiswa.

Umsebenzi wokuvikelwa kwegebe ukuvikela ukuphepha kokuvikela iphuzu elingathathi hlangothi lephuzu elingathathi hlangothi le-transformer.

Ukuvikelwa kwegebe kutholakala ngokusebenzisa igebe lamanje i-3I0 eligeleza ngephuzu elingathathi hlangothi le-transformer kanye ne-open delta voltage 3U0 ye-busbar PT njengomgomo.

Uma iphuzu elingathathi hlangothi lephutha likhuphukela endaweni, igebe liyahlehla futhi kwenziwa igebe elikhulu lamanje i-3I0. Ngalesi sikhathi, ukuvikelwa kwegebe kuyasebenza futhi i-transformer iyanqunywa ngemuva kokubambezeleka. Ngaphezu kwalokho, lapho iphutha lomhlabathi livela ohlelweni, iphuzu lokungathathi hlangothi libekwe phansi futhi ukuvikelwa kokulandelana kwe-zero kwe-transformer kuyasebenza, futhi iphuzu lokungathathi hlangothi libekwe kuqala. Ngemuva kokuthi uhlelo lulahlekelwe indawo yokubeka phansi, uma iphutha lisekhona, i-delta voltage 3U0 evulekile ye-busbar PT izoba nkulu kakhulu, futhi ukuvikelwa kwegebe nakho kuzosebenza ngalesi sikhathi.
